Heim >Web-Frontend >Front-End-Fragen und Antworten >Kann Javascript interaktive Funktionen erreichen?

Kann Javascript interaktive Funktionen erreichen?

WBOY
WBOYOriginal
2023-05-21 09:56:0722289Durchsuche

Mit der Entwicklung des Internets müssen immer mehr Websites und Anwendungen interaktive Funktionen implementieren, und diese interaktiven Funktionen erfordern häufig die Verwendung der JavaScript-Sprache. Obwohl JavaScript seit langem eine sehr beliebte Programmiersprache im Bereich der Webentwicklung ist, werden einige unerfahrene Entwickler oder Personen, die noch nicht mit JavaScript vertraut sind, Zweifel haben, ob JavaScript wirklich interaktive Funktionen erreichen kann. Dieser Artikel soll erklären, warum die JavaScript-Sprache umfangreiche interaktive Funktionen und verwandte Technologien erreichen kann, um diese Fragen zu lösen.

Lassen Sie uns zunächst verstehen, was JavaScript ist. JavaScript ist eine objektorientierte Programmiersprache, die in HTML-Dateien eingebettet werden kann, um die Interaktivität von Websites und Anwendungen zu verbessern. Im Vergleich zu Python, C++, Java und anderen Sprachen weist JavaScript eine relativ einfache Syntax und Lernkurve auf. Es erfordert keine Installation oder Kompilierung und kann direkt im Browser ausgeführt werden. Durch Bearbeiten und Parsen von JavaScript-Code können umfangreiche interaktive Funktionen für Websites und Anwendungen erreicht werden.

JavaScript kann viele interaktive Funktionen implementieren:

  1. Formularüberprüfung: JavaScript kann Fehleraufforderungen, Formatüberprüfung und andere Funktionen implementieren, indem es den Formulareingabeinhalt überprüft, um sicherzustellen, dass die vom Benutzer eingegebenen Informationen korrekt sind . Richtigkeit, Rechtmäßigkeit und Vollständigkeit.
  2. Dynamische Effekte: JavaScript kann mit DOM (Document Object Model) und CSS (Cascading Style Sheets) kombiniert werden, um dynamische Effekte von Bildern, Text, Hintergründen und anderen Elementen in Webseiten, wie Karussells, Faltmenüs usw., zu erzielen.
  3. AJAX: JavaScript kann mit Back-End-Daten interagieren und über HTTP-Anfragen und -Antworten aktualisierungsfreie Aktualisierungen von Webseiten realisieren, was die Benutzererfahrung erheblich verbessert.
  4. Ereignisreaktion: JavaScript kann Ereignisüberwachung, Ereignisverarbeitungsfunktionen und andere Technologien verwenden, um Reaktionen während der Benutzerinteraktion zu implementieren, z. B. Klicken, Ziehen, Scrollen usw.
  5. Webseiteninhalt dynamisch generieren: JavaScript kann Vorlagen-Engines, Datenbindung und andere Technologien verwenden, um den Effekt der dynamischen Generierung von Webseiten zu erzielen, z. B. Rendering-Listen, Paging, Suche und andere Funktionen.

Zusätzlich zu einigen der oben aufgeführten Funktionen kann JavaScript auch viele andere interaktive Funktionen implementieren, wie z. B. 3D-Animationseffekte, responsives Webdesign, Webspiele usw.

Um diese interaktiven Funktionen zu erreichen, unterstützt JavaScript viele Technologien und Frameworks. Lassen Sie uns die häufig verwendeten Technologien und Frameworks vorstellen:

  1. jQuery: jQuery ist eine Open-Source-JavaScript-Bibliothek, die eine praktische API bereitstellt und die Bearbeitung von DOM-Elementen in JavaScript einfacher und schneller macht.
  2. React: React ist eine Open-Source-JavaScript-Bibliothek, die hauptsächlich zum Erstellen von Benutzeroberflächen verwendet wird. Ihre Kernidee ist die Komponentisierung, mit der effizienter und wartbarer Code erzielt werden kann.
  3. Vue.js: Vue.js ist ein beliebtes JavaScript-Framework, das auch zum Erstellen von Benutzeroberflächen verwendet wird. Es ist React sehr ähnlich, für einige Entwickler weist Vue.js jedoch eine sanftere Lernkurve auf.
  4. Angular: Angular ist ein großes JavaScript-Framework, das von Google zum Erstellen dynamischer Webanwendungen entwickelt wurde. Es umfasst viele Tools und Techniken, mit denen eine breite Palette von Anwendungen erstellt werden kann, von einfachen Einzelseitenanwendungen bis hin zu komplexen Anwendungen auf Unternehmensebene.

Zusätzlich zu den oben aufgeführten JavaScript-Frameworks stehen viele weitere Frameworks und Technologien zur Verfügung, die die Entwicklung komfortabler, effizienter, flexibler und wartbarer machen.

Kurz gesagt, JavaScript kann sehr umfangreiche interaktive Funktionen erreichen und ist zu einem unverzichtbaren Bestandteil der Webprogrammierung geworden. Durch das Erlernen von JavaScript und verwandten Technologien und Frameworks können Entwickler problemlos verschiedene komplexe interaktive Funktionen von Websites und Anwendungen implementieren und ein besseres Benutzererlebnis bieten.

Das obige ist der detaillierte Inhalt vonKann Javascript interaktive Funktionen erreichen?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Vorheriger Artikel:Wie lerne ich Javascript?Nächster Artikel:Wie lerne ich Javascript?